Output de8abd155568f94bdd327217c5b420b024c16610d9780d7ff028deea7f285868:27

value
3535632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4cf9f2d94aa3f55e8df2953a82a1a406138a1b4 OP_EQUAL
address
3GiTTpSZtdN3hA3SNNwGETnuTs7Z7hk8uR
transaction
de8abd155568f94bdd327217c5b420b024c16610d9780d7ff028deea7f285868
spent
true